Senior Divisional Mechanical Engineer (Diesel), Jamalpur, the administrative head of Jamalpur Diesel shed in Malda Division, Eastern Railway. He is overall in-charge of Diesel as well as Electric loco maintenance and is assisted by one Assistant Divisional Mechanical Engineers (T), one Assistant Material Manager and one Assistant Chemist and Metallurgist.

Diesel Shed, Jamalpur

Diesel Shed, Jamalpur of Mechanical Engineering department is associated with maintenance of different types of Diesel & Electrical Locomotives. Presently, this shed has holding of 47 Diesel & 51 Electric Locomotives of Eastern Railway specializing in the fields of Diesel Loco maintenance and Electric Loco Maintenance.



Lay Out OF DIESEL SHED JAMALPUR

The shed has berthing capacity of 16 Locomotives for maintenance of 47 + 51 = 98 locomotives – divided into Major, Medium and Minor Sections each having overhead crane and allied facilities

A small machine shop caters to all the miscellaneous works. A wheel lathe (of M/s. HEC/RANCHI make and one water Load Box plant, one ETP plant & two nos. compressor have been commissioned and working satisfactorily.



 

JAMALPURDIESEL SHED:

 

1.      Year of establishment: 1991

 

2.      Present Status :

·The shed presently homes 40 WDG3A, 07 WDM3A, 04 WAG5 and 47 WAG7 Electric locomotives.

 

·Nos of Diesel Locomotives being utilized in Goods service: 9.0 Nos.

 

·Nos. of Electric Locomotives being utilized in Goods service: 41.31

 

·There are eight three-level platforms and two hoisting pits. A total of sixteen locos can be berthed at a time under the covered shed.

 

·The shed also houses a pit wheel lathe, which apart from the in-house requirement, caters to the wheel turning of rolling stock of MLDT Division.

 

·The Gazetted cadre of the shed consists of a Sr. DME(D), DME(D), ADME(D), ADME (Tr), AMM (D) & ACMT (D).

4.      Best Diesel shed Award (ER) :     

  Diesel Shed, Jamalpur has won   “Best Diesel Shed Award” for its  performance during the year    2005-06, 2007-08, 2009-10, 2011-12 & 2012-13

5.      MT Award :    Disel Shed, Jamalpur won “MT       Award” for the year 16-17 for                                       overall punctual running of   locomotives.
